Bravo makes blind bet

NBC Universal’s Bravo announced that it has given a blind multi-project development deal to Picture This Television, two-time Emmy winners for their work on Bravo’s “Kathy Griffin: My Life on the D-List.” The agreement covers unscripted series and specials.


“Bravo has enjoyed a long and fruitful partnership with the talented producers at Picture This Television. We are looking forward to teaming up with them once again on new ventures that will have the same stamp of excellence as our previous collaborations,” said Frances Berwick, Executive Vice President and General Manager, Bravo Media.

Picture This Television co-owners Bryan Scott and Lisa M. Tucker executive produce Bravo’s “Kathy Griffin: My Life On The D List,” and were instrumental in making some of the series’ most memorable moments happen, including Griffin’s trip to Iraq to entertain the troops.

“We’re thrilled to continue our successful relationship with Bravo. We look forward to developing more cutting edge programming that penetrates pop culture and gets people talking and watching,” said a joint statement from Scott and Tucker.

Picture This Television also produced six seasons of “Celebrity Poker Showdown” for Bravo. The company’s additional credits include the series “Sex… with Mom and Dad” starring Dr. Drew Pinsky, and “The Cooking Loft.”
